What is IELTS?
IELTS is a standardized test that determines English language proficiency throughout four essential skills: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king. The test assesses a person's capability to interact successfully in scholastic and professional contexts. It is acknowledged by over 10,000 companies worldwide, including universities, companies, immigration authorities, and expert bodies.

Q1: How typically can I take the IELTS exam?
A1: You can take the IELTS exam as many times as you want. Nevertheless, it is recommended to permit enough time for preparation before retaking the test.
Q2: How long are Ielts Online Pakistan scores valid?
A2: IELTS scores are normally legitimate for two years from the test date. After that, they are thought about expired for admission or migration purposes.
Q3: Can I change my test date?
A3: Yes, prospects can alter their test date however should do so a minimum of 5 weeks before the scheduled date. A fee may use.
Q4: Is there a minimum age requirement for taking the IELTS?
A4: The minimum age requirement is 16 years. However, some universities might have greater age requirements for admission.
